Woodlands schedules Earth Day GreenUp Event
The Woodlands Earth Day GreenUp is scheduled for Saturday, April 16.
The event lets people connect with neighbors and the outdoors by joining or leading a cleanup crew bagging trash from streets, pathways and streams.
The schedule for the day starts with check-in from 8:30 a.m. to 9 a.m. at a designated park. There, people will pick up their supplies and receive a map to their cleanup site.
From 9 a.m. to 11 a.m., people will go to their location and start the cleanup process. They will deposit bags and large items at designated sites throughout the community or bring the bags to the post-pickup party.
And from 11:30 a.m. to 2:30 p.m., people will celebrate in the spirit of Earth Day at Rob Fleming Park, located at 6055 Creekside Forest Drive, with food, fun, participation awards and a prize drawing. Music will be provided by the Buck Yeager Band.
